Italian plantmaker Danieli’s subsidiary Danieli Centro Combustion has announced that Danieli Olivotto Ferrè, part of Danieli Centro Combustion, will supply a new bell-type annealing plant for Turkish long steel producing group Diler Holding’s subsidiary Diler Iron and Steel Industry and Trade Inc.
The new plant will be installed at the company’s plant in Dilovası, Kocaeli, and is designed mainly for spheroidizing annealing of wire rods in coils, with coils having outside diameters in the range of 1,250-1,400 mm and with wire rod diameters in the range of 4.5-27 mm.
According to Danieli Centro Combustion, the plant will process coils under a nitrogen protective atmosphere and will consist of three bases designed for a maximum workload capacity of 40 mt, plus two bell furnaces and a cooling hood.
Established in 1984, Diler Iron and Steel Industry and Trade Inc., is specialized in wire rods for automotive applications.
